Understanding the Culture Around Sugar Daddy Sites Today
Sugar daddy sites have become more than just a trend; they’re a part of modern dating culture. If you’ve heard about them but aren’t sure what they are or how they work, you’re not alone. Let’s break it down.
At their core, sugar daddy sites connect people looking for mutually beneficial relationships. Typically, older men (sugar daddies) seek companionship and are willing to provide financial support to younger individuals (sugar babies) in return. It sounds simple, right? But the dynamics can get complex.
Many people think these sites are all about wealth and glamour. Sure, some sugar babies might enjoy fancy dinners and expensive gifts. But it’s not just about the money. For many, it’s about companionship and connections that traditional dating might not offer. You might find someone who appreciates your company and vice versa. That can be refreshing compared to the usual dating scene, which often feels like a game.
However, not everything is rosy. There are some misconceptions. Some folks assume all sugar babies are just in it for the cash. But that’s not always the case. Many seek a specific type of relationship that offers emotional support as well. Just like any relationship, it takes trust and clear communication. Both parties need to be upfront about their expectations to avoid misunderstandings.
A lot of people are still wary about sugar daddy sites. There’s a stigma attached. Some think they’re exploitative or only for people looking for quick cash. But it’s important to recognize that every relationship, whether traditional or unconventional, has its risks. It’s crucial to prioritize safety. Meeting in public places, setting clear boundaries, and trusting your gut feelings can go a long way.
For many young people today, sugar daddy sites offer an alternative to the conventional dating landscape. In a world where student debt and rising living costs are pressing issues, some see these relationships as a practical solution. These sites can provide a financial cushion that allows sugar babies to pursue goals or simply enjoy life a little more.
Social media plays a role in shaping perceptions, too. Platforms like TikTok and Instagram showcase glam lifestyles that some associate with sugar dating. Influencers often share their experiences, which can mislead new users. It’s essential to sift through these images and understand that real-life scenarios are often less glamorous.
